The Indonesia Flooring Paint Market was valued at USD 285.4 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 482.6 million by 2034, at a CAGR of 9.2% during the forecast period (2025–2034). This growth is driven by rapid industrial expansion, infrastructure development, the rising demand for durable and protective coatings, and a high VOC compliance rate of 96%.

Flooring paint is a specialized coating formulated to protect, strengthen, and enhance the aesthetic appeal of floor surfaces in industrial, commercial, and residential settings. It offers resistance to abrasion, chemicals, moisture, and heavy traffic, making it essential for factories, warehouses, airports, and high-traffic public buildings.

Java

Java is the undisputed leading region in the Indonesia Flooring Paint market, driven by its immense industrial and commercial density. The island is home to the nation’s primary industrial estates and Special Economic Zones, which drives continuous demand for high-performance flooring coatings. The presence of major international and domestic paint manufacturers and their distribution headquarters ensures superior product availability and technical support. The region benefits from robust infrastructure development, ongoing urbanization, and a high concentration of manufacturing facilities, logistics hubs, and commercial complexes, all of which require durable floor protection. Stringent enforcement of industrial safety standards in Java’s major cities further pushes the adoption of certified, high-quality flooring paint solutions. This combination of high demand, strong supply chains, and regulatory drivers solidifies Java’s dominant market position.

Industrial & Commercial Hub
The industrial corridors of Greater Jakarta, Surabaya, and Cikarang are central to market demand. High concentrations of manufacturing plants, warehouses, and automotive facilities necessitate specialized, durable epoxy and polyurethane floor coatings that withstand heavy traffic and chemical exposure, making this the primary application segment.
Infrastructure & Urbanization
Rapid infrastructure development, including new airports, commercial towers, and public facilities in cities across Java, creates sustained demand. Mega-projects mandate the use of high-grade, anti-slip, and aesthetically pleasing flooring systems, with a strong preference for waterborne technologies in modern, eco-conscious builds.
Supply Chain & Distribution
Java hosts the national headquarters and main production facilities of key market players, ensuring the fastest and most reliable supply of flooring paints. This logistical advantage allows for better inventory management, prompt technical service, and faster adoption of new product formulations compared to other regions.
Regulatory Environment
Stricter enforcement of workplace safety and environmental regulations in Java’s industrial zones drives the specification of VOC‑compliant and certified non‑slip flooring paints. This regulatory pressure creates a mature market for advanced, performance‑driven coating solutions over basic products.

Sumatra
Sumatra represents a significant and growing market, fueled by its expansive palm oil, rubber, and mining industries. The need for heavy‑duty, chemical‑resistant flooring in processing plants and warehouses is a key driver. Major port cities like Medan and Palembang are hubs for commercial and industrial activity, supporting demand. Infrastructure projects, particularly those related to energy and resource extraction, further contribute to the regional market. However, supply chain logistics can be more challenging compared to Java, sometimes affecting product availability and technical support timelines in more remote industrial areas.

Kalimantan
The flooring paint market in Kalimantan is primarily driven by the mining and oil & gas sectors. The demand centers on highly specialized coatings capable of withstanding extreme conditions in processing facilities and offshore support bases. Urban development in cities like Balikpapan and Samarinda also contributes to commercial and residential demand. The market is characterized by a focus on product durability and specific performance certifications required by major resource companies, though the distribution network is less dense than in Java, favoring larger project‑based supply deals.

Sulawesi
Sulawesi’s market is emerging, supported by government‑led infrastructure initiatives and the growth of its nickel processing industry. The development of new industrial parks, particularly in the context of downstream mineral processing, is creating fresh demand for industrial flooring solutions. The region shows potential for growth but is currently constrained by a less developed distribution network for specialized coatings and a reliance on supplies from Java‑based manufacturers, which can lead to longer lead times.

Eastern Indonesia (Maluku, Papua, Nusa Tenggara)
This region represents a smaller, niche market focused predominantly on project‑specific demand, often linked to large‑scale government infrastructure or resource development projects. The remoteness of many areas results in higher costs and logistical complexities for supplying flooring paints. Demand is sporadic and tied to individual large projects, such as new seaports or mining facilities, with a high requirement for products that can perform in challenging tropical marine environments.
